South Dakota Attorney General Marty Jackley is warning people about money donation scams that have appeared in recent days from so-called organizations trying to raise funds to help victims of the wildfires in Maui, Hawaii.
Jackley says with disasters, unfortunately come those who are looking to deceive the public. He says the Hawaii Governor’s Office is directing donors to contribute to the following three organizations:
-
the American Red Cross,
-
the Hawaii Community Foundation,
-
or directly to the Maui Strong Fund via their website.
People with questions about any donation requests can contact the Attorney General’s Consumer Protection Office at 1-800-300-1986 or consumerhelp@state.sd.us.
